The Enchanted Reflection: The Mirror's Enslaved Prince

In the heart of the ancient kingdom of Aetheria, where the sun kissed the horizon with a golden glow, lay the grand palace of Lumina. It was a place of wonder, where the air shimmered with magic and the walls whispered tales of old. The prince, Aelion, was the son of the kingdom's benevolent ruler, the King of Lumina. He was known for his courage, wisdom, and the golden hair that mirrored the sun's own radiance.

One fateful evening, as the moon hung like a silver coin in the sky, Aelion was summoned to the grand hall. There, standing before him was the court magician, Elara, a woman with eyes as deep as the ocean and a smile that could light up the darkest night. She held a mirror, its surface as clear as crystal but with a faint, eerie glow.

"The mirror holds the secrets of the universe," Elara began, her voice like a lullaby that promised sweet dreams but held a hint of danger. "But it is also a trap, for those who look upon it too deeply."

Aelion, intrigued and unafraid, peered into the mirror. The reflection that met his gaze was not his own but that of a young prince, with eyes like storm clouds and a face marred by sorrow. The prince reached out to touch the image, and as his fingers brushed the glass, a strange sensation coursed through his veins.

The next morning, Aelion awoke in a strange, dark realm, the mirror now a heavy weight upon his chest. The prince before him was his own reflection, but this was no mere illusion. The mirror had cast him into a land of shadows and deceit, where the mirror's prince, Elion, was enslaved by the evil sorcerer, Malakar.

Malakar, a being of immense power, had captured Elion and used his heart's pain to bind him to the mirror. Now, Elion was Malakar's pawn, a vessel of darkness that served the sorcerer's every whim. Aelion, however, was not to be so easily defeated.

In the land of shadows, Aelion discovered that he had the power to influence the mirror's prince through his own actions. With each kind word, each brave act, he could alter Elion's perception and, in turn, weaken Malakar's hold on him. But the path to freedom was fraught with peril, and Aelion would have to face the darkest corners of his own soul to find the strength to break the curse.

As Aelion journeyed through the shadow realm, he encountered creatures of both beauty and terror. He fought off the ghoulish minions of Malakar and outwitted the riddles posed by the enigmatic guardian of the Mirror's Gate. Yet, the greatest challenge lay within, for Aelion had to confront the truth about his own past and the reasons behind his curse.

In a moment of revelation, Aelion learned that his father, the King of Lumina, had once been a powerful sorcerer who had sought to control the mirror's power. In his quest for immortality, the king had sealed his own son in the mirror, binding him to a life of suffering. It was a betrayal that had torn the kingdom apart and led to the rise of Malakar.

Armed with this knowledge, Aelion set out to break the curse that bound him to the mirror. He faced the sorcerer in a climactic battle that tested the limits of his courage and will. In the end, it was Elion's own act of self-sacrifice that freed Aelion from the mirror's hold, allowing him to return to his kingdom.

Upon his return, Aelion was greeted as a hero. The people of Lumina were relieved to have their prince back, and the king, humbled by his son's bravery, offered his full support. Aelion, however, knew that the battle against Malakar was far from over. The sorcerer had escaped, and the kingdom would need to stand united against the darkness that still threatened to consume them.

In the aftermath of the battle, Aelion and Elion became fast friends, their bond forged in the fires of adversity. Together, they worked to rebuild the kingdom, ensuring that the lessons of the past would not be forgotten. And so, the tale of the Enchanted Reflection: The Mirror's Enslaved Prince became a legend, a reminder that even in the darkest of times, the light of hope and courage could shine through.

As the sun dipped below the horizon, casting a golden glow upon the land, Aelion stood on the battlements of Lumina, watching the sunset. The mirror lay broken at his feet, a symbol of the past and a testament to the power of redemption. The kingdom was safe, but the journey was far from over. Aelion knew that the true test of his leadership and the strength of his people lay ahead, and he was ready to face whatever challenges lay in store.
